KUALA LUMPUR: Relocating Chinese primary schools with low enrolment is the right strategy to ensure their survival, says MCA deputy president Datuk Dr Wee Ka Siong.
He said the move would also help the continuous development of these “micro schools”, which had a high demand among the Chinese community.
